PREVIEW: FLYERS @ FLAMES

Kicking off a three-game road trip through western Canada, Dave Hakstol's Philadelphia Flyers (27-22-7) are in Alberta to take on Glen Gulutzan's Calgary Flames (28-26-3) on Wednesday afternoon. Game time at the Saddledome is 9:30 p.m. ET. The game will be televised locally on CSN Philadelphia.

This is the second and final meeting this season between the inter-conference teams, and the lone game in Calgary. On Nov. 27 at the Wells Fargo Center, the Flyers skated to a 5-3 win.

Flyers Outlook

The Flyers have gone 2-3-1 since the All-Star break. The team salvaged a 2-2-1 homestand on Saturday with a 2-1 overtime victory against the San Jose Sharks. Wayne Simmonds notched the game winning goal on a breakaway after stripping Brent Burns of the puck. Ivan Provorov snapped a scoreless deadlock in the third period to briefly put Philadelphia ahead, 1-0. Michal Neuvirth stopped 23 of 24 shots to earn the win in goal.

On the injury front, the Flyers may have defenseman Michael Del Zotto (right leg) back in the lineup. He is at least available for duty, and could step back into replace one of the other defensemen. Rookie forward Travis Konecny (lower-body injury), who is expected to be out until mid-to-late March, is on the injured reserve list.

Flames Outlook

The Flames bring a 14-14-0 home record into Wednesday's game and are 4-6-0 in their last 10 games. On Monday, the Flames could not solve Mike Smith on 36 shots and lost 5-0 to the visiting Arizona Coyotes.

Johnny Gaudreau was demoted to the fourth line by Gulutzan during Monday's game after a costly turnover on a low-percentage play. However, it unlikely the change will carry over. Brian Elliott is the expected starter in goal.

On the injury front, Ladislav Smid is on long-term injured reserve after multiple neck surgeries.
